Ultra-Fast Material Switching

Unlike most conventional 3D printers, Cetus2 employs advanced dual extrusion technology and a unique nozzle design which enables seamless switching between two materials and colors on the fly. Cetus2 is capable of fast material switching while the print process is underway, opening up a new world of creative 3D printing.

 

Time Saving & Material Saving

No need for nozzle alignment, this unique single nozzle design saves you time and lets you start 3D printing with ease. With no need to stop or print purge tower, printing time is optimized by eliminating the complicated and lengthy procedure of swapping out one filament for another. Dedicated Powerful Software

New System New Future

The newly developed software for the Cetus2 multi-material system allows you to define every position of material switching on the model with a simple setup. Usually, designers need to set colors by dividing models into different parts, this may require advanced modeling skills. Now with Tiertime UP Studio 3, you can always add the color later, in a few simple steps!

 

Powerful & User Friendly

Cetus2’s self-developed software is powerful yet simple to use for voxel-level 3D printing. You are able to select a customized bitmap to paste on the model. Simply load your model, adjust the position of the subject, and select image texture, you're good to go. After easy settings to suit your preference, you can slice and be ready for your artwork.

Fully Automatic Leveling and Z-Level Calibration

Manual leveling can be tedious and time-consuming, which can discourage people from getting started with 3D printing. With a built-in sensor, Cetus2 is able to initialize with Fully Automatic Leveling and Z-Level Calibration to prepare for any task, saving you time and eliminating complicated setup.

 

Stable WI-FI Connectivity

You can use Micro USB or a TF Card to upload models you wish to print, or you can control and send print jobs to Cetus2 remotely – through its Stable WI-FI connection. Powered by Expressif, an industrial leader in WiFi and AIOT chip design, this new printer CPU will give the printer massive improvement on WI-FI stability. Capable of OTA upgrade, users will be able to update printer firmware easily with TF Card or WI-FI.

 

Touch Screen Control

Featuring a responsive touch screen, set-ups and configurations can be done on Cetus2 easily and intuitively, which allows you to enjoy a simple and visualized 3D printing experience.

Easy, Safe & Intelligent

With a built-in intelligent filament detection module, Cetus2 increases the success rate of printing by ensuring the accurate loading of filament. It also pauses printing and notifies you when the filament is running out or broken. In addition, Cetus2 has a recovery mode that saves the printing progress in the event of a power outage and resumes the process after power is restored so you never lose a print.

Fast & Silent Printing

The steel linear guideway of Cetus2 provides the stability and strength for high-level printing performance with reliability and accuracy. The advanced TMC Silent Stepper Driver makes the whole machine silent during printing. 3D printing no longer distracts making Cetus2 a better choice for home printing or classroom settings.
